You can visit the Champs-Élysées and walk on a trail created in the 17th century by Louis XIV's gardener. The iconic 1.2-mile stretch from Place de la Concorde to the Arc de Triomphe is lined by some of the world's most expensive retail spaces and comes alive during cultural events like Bastille Day parades and the Tour de France finale. During the 2024 Summer Olympics, it also acted as a pathway for cycling, marathon, and race walking events adding another chapter to the boulevard's legacy.
